Output 057a89e33c834ae53ff261bb49139d212acc477a0bc0ab8d19ad5574d94a8b6b:57

value
31526676
script pubkey
OP_0 OP_PUSHBYTES_20 17c6fceb652e18de6eee68401cf9c1bc04cc0b7c
address
bc1qzlr0e6m99cvdumhwdpqpe7wphszvczmu2wazsq
transaction
057a89e33c834ae53ff261bb49139d212acc477a0bc0ab8d19ad5574d94a8b6b
confirmations
218547
spent
true